How Our Moisture Mapping Process Works

When you call us for Moisture Mapping, our team will walk you through a step-by-step process designed to uncover hidden moisture issues and prevent further dam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to scan for moisture, identify areas of concern, and develop a plan to dry out your property. We know that corners cut in Moisture Mapping can lead to bigger problems down the line, so we take the time to do it right.

Step 1: Moisture Scanning

We’ll use advanced moisture-scanning equipment to identify areas of concern in your property. This step typically takes around 30 minutes to an hour, depending on the size of your property.

Step 2: Moisture Mapping

Our team will create a detailed map of your property’s moisture levels, highlighting areas of concern and identifying potential sources of the issue. This step typically takes around 1-2 hours, depending on the size of your property.

Step 3: Drying and Repair

Once we’ve identified the source of the moisture issue, our team will develop a plan to dry out your property and make any necessary repairs. This step can take anywhere from a few hours to several days, depending on the severity of the issue.

Step 4: Follow-up and Verification

We’ll schedule a follow-up visit to verify that the moisture issue has been resolved and that your property is dry and safe. This step typically takes around 30 minutes to an hour.

Moisture Mapping Cost in Wagener, SC

The cost of Moisture Mapping services in Wagener, SC can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ates typically range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the complexity of the job.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Moisture Scanning $200 – $500 Size of property and complexity of issue
Moisture Mapping $500 – $1,500 Size of property and complexity of issue
Drying and Repair $1,000 – $3,000 Severity of issue and materials required
Follow-up and Verification $100 – $300 Size of property and complexity of issue
